ARSONISTS who started a blaze in a school bin caused more than £150,000 damage.

Three fire crews were called to Princes Risborough Upper School in Merton Road on Sunday at 10pm after the fire started in a paper recycling bin and spread to a nearby room.

Detective Constable Mark Darnbrough said: "We are currently investigating the incident. We don't however believe that whoever started the fire intended to cause this amount of damage to the school."
